Frequently Asked Questions

What is PPSSPP Gold - PSP emulator and what are its main features?

PPSSPP Gold is an enhanced version of the popular PPSSPP emulator that allows users to play PSP games on their Android or iOS devices. It boasts high-definition graphics and a smoother gameplay experience compared to its free counterpart. The app also supports save states, customizable controls, and the ability to run games from ISO or CSO files, ensuring a versatile gaming experience.

Is PPSSPP Gold - PSP emulator free to use?

No, PPSSPP Gold is not free; it is a paid version of the PPSSPP emulator. While there is a free version available, purchasing the Gold version supports the developers and provides users with an ad-free experience and potentially more stable performance. The cost is a one-time purchase, making it a worthwhile investment for serious gamers.

Which devices are compatible with PPSSPP Gold - PSP emulator?

PPSSPP Gold is compatible with a wide range of devices. It works on Android devices running version 2.3 and above and iOS devices with jailbroken systems. It is also available for Windows, macOS, and Linux, making it accessible for PC users. However, the performance may vary depending on the device's hardware capabilities.

How is the performance of PPSSPP Gold - PSP emulator compared to playing games on a PSP console?

The performance of PPSSPP Gold can vary depending on the device used. Generally, it provides an excellent replication of PSP gaming with enhanced graphics and sound quality. However, some games might experience minor glitches or slowdowns, especially on lower-end devices. High-end smartphones and tablets usually deliver a smooth and enjoyable gaming experience comparable to the original PSP console.

Can I use PPSSPP Gold to play all PSP games?

While PPSSPP Gold supports a vast majority of PSP games, it may not be compatible with every single title. Some games might not run perfectly due to differences in system architecture or other technical limitations. However, the developers continually update the emulator to improve compatibility, so it's always a good idea to check the latest version and community forums for specific game support.
